COMMONWEALTH v. ZACHARY Z.

SJC-11021.

462 Mass. 319 (2012)

COMMONWEALTH v. ZACHARY Z., a juvenile.

Supreme Judicial Court of Massachusetts, Suffolk.

May 24, 2012.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Kathleen Celio, Assistant District Attorney, for the Commonwealth.

Peter M. Onek, Committee for Public Counsel Services, for the juvenile.

Patrick Murphy & Sarah Rothenberg, for Parent/Professional Advocacy League & others, amici curiae, submitted a brief.

Present: IRELAND, C.J., SPINA, CORDY, BOTSFORD, GANTS, & DUFFLY, JJ.


BOTSFORD, J.

In December of 2008, the juvenile was charged with delinquency by reason of armed robbery. He was identified as the robber by means of a photograph that the police had obtained from his public high school and claimed to have included in a photographic array shown to the alleged victim. The juvenile moved to suppress the identification, and a Juvenile Court judge granted his motion. A single justice of this court...
